How to Repair Double Glazed Windows

Over time, double glazing windows may become damaged. This can cause condensation or a loss of the seal which makes windows less efficient.

Some homeowners might be tempted to fix the issue on their own, but it's better to seek out a reputable tradesperson. This will save money and ensure that your window repair is completed correctly.

Cost

Double glazing windows are covered by a warranty, and it's important to know what the warranty is and when it will expire. It is important to repair windows immediately if they become difficult to open or if there is moisture between the glass panes. In the event of delay, it could void the warranty, which means you'll be required to pay for a full replacement.

The cost of fixing windows with double glazing will be based on the type of issue and how serious the issue is. If your window is shattered, it'll be much more expensive than if the glass is just misting up. This issue could be caused by damage to the seals or from general wear and tear, but this is often a fix without the need to replace the entire window unit.

Most likely, the misting is the result of water vapour leaking between the two panes. This needs to be repaired as quickly as possible because it can decrease insulation efficiency and could pose a safety risk.

To correct this issue, the technician will make small holes in the glass. This will allow the moisture to escape. This will take anywhere from a few hours to several days, depending on the dimensions and style of the window. After the windows have been cleaned and sealed, they are then resealed and equipped with vents to allow moisture and air to let out naturally.

The cost of double-glazing windows repair can vary according to the company you choose and the size of the work to be completed. Some companies provide online estimates that can be a useful indication of the expected costs of a repair. It is best to have a company survey the property before submitting a quote.

Double-glazed windows might not be the most affordable but as a long-term investment, they can save you money. Retrofitting existing frames is a cheaper option than replacing them. This is a more cost-effective option and also help you save time and effort.

Warranty

The warranty on double-glazed windows is an essential element of your purchase. It is important to read it before you sign any paperwork. It will protect your investment. A warranty can cover a wide range of issues, including misty windows or condensation, or structural damage. The warranty should be clear on what it covers, and any associated costs.

Condensation between the panes is among the most common problems associated with double glazing. This happens by the gas that insulates the glass is broken down and moisture leaks in. This is a natural occurrence but it could affect the performance of your windows. If you notice this problem it is recommended that you get in touch with the manufacturer to arrange for a repair or replacement.

A gap between the double-glazed windows could also be a problem. This can be caused by storms, wind or other environmental factors. This typically requires replacement of all window panes. However, some companies offer a reseal option to resolve this problem. This can save you money in the final, but you must consider your budget when choosing this option.

If you decide to sell your house in accordance with the age and condition of your double-glazed windows, the warranty may transfer to the new owner. This is a great way to get the most from your investment and protect your buyer.

Double-glazed windows typically come with warranties of between 10 and 20 years, although some come with lifetime warranties. It is important to be aware that some warranties exclude maintenance and repair. If double glazing near me don't take care you could be liable for costly repairs in the future.

It is crucial to be aware of the warranty coverage on double-glazed windows in order to avoid future costly repairs. Typically warranties cover the costs of labor and the materials required to repair or replace defective or damaged components. This includes replacement of window frames and hardware. The warranty should also cover any films, or other coatings with energy-efficient properties on the glass.

Aesthetics

Double glazing windows can increase the value of the home. They make a house look more appealing and also help keep heat in during winter months and out during the summer. Like all household items they are susceptible to damage and need to be replaced or repaired from time to time. It is important to fix double-glazed windows that have damaged or chipped pane as quickly as you can in order to avoid further damage. There are many options for fixing damaged or cracked double glazing windows, however some are more effective than others.

A cracked or chipped window is usually repaired with an adhesive placed within the cracks to stop them from growing or becoming worse in time. This kind of repair, while temporary, can help to stop further damage from occurring. It also helps keep the glass in its place until it can replaced. This type of repair is usually performed by an experienced installer and is usually much less expensive than replacing the entire window.

Misted windows are another common problem with double glazing that is difficult to fix, but there are solutions. One alternative is to reseal windows. This can be accomplished by adding a new desiccant and putty to the seal. This is not a good option for argon gas-filled windows, though, as the insulating effect will be removed.

Another option is to apply a special film that is designed to bond to the surface of windows and help seal the gaps. This is an effective option if the windows are misted only a little and doesn't cost as much as replacing the whole window.

Broken hinges and handles are also quite common problems that can be easily repaired as long as the frames and glazing are in good condition. A new hinge or handle can be purchased cheaply and fitted quickly. They can also improve the appearance of the window and make it easier to open. If the handle or lock is broken completely, it will need replacing since this can compromise the security of your home and allow drafts in.

Energy efficiency


Double glazing offers a number of advantages such as energy efficiency and a higher value to your home. These benefits can be lost if double glazing is not properly maintained.

You must clean your double glazing on a regular basis to remove dirt and dust. This will prevent condensation between the panes and help keep the window in good working order. Every year, you should examine the frame of your window for wear and damage to ensure it is in good shape and does not require repair or replacement.

It's important that you get the window that has been damaged repaired as soon as you can. Broken windows could mean that the seal isn't working and water can leak into your home. This can result in damage to the insulation of your home and create a security threat.

Double-glazed windows can be replaced by an Insulated Glass Unit (IGU), which uses two glass panes and the gas argon or krypton in between to reduce the transfer of heat. This is a far more efficient method to make your home more energy efficient than single-pane windows. Replacement is more expensive than repairing your existing windows.

Replacing your double-glazed windows can improve the appearance of your home and increase the value of its resales. Additionally, it can reduce your energy costs and lower noise levels. It is essential to select the appropriate type of double glazing replacement for your home as different options offer different degrees of energy efficiency.

You should choose a double-glazed window with low thermal conductivity, or U-value. The lower the U-value is, the more efficient it is in energy use. The most efficient double-glazed window has an U-value of less than 0.6.

If you're unsure if you should replace your double glazing or not, you can get an expert to inspect your home and give you a firm estimate. This will take a few hours and you should arrange a time that works for your schedule. The tradesman must also measure your windows and openings prior to ordering the new windows. This will ensure that you get the correct size windows and prevent any future issues.
